Finality

  • Divorce: A divorce is a permanent termination of the marital relationship. As soon as a divorce is settled, the couple is no longer legally married.
  • Legal Separation: Legal separation offers an alternative to divorce for couples who may not be ready to completely end their marriage. It uses a momentary plan where spouses live apart but remain legally married.
  • Legal Status

  • Divorce: Following a divorce, both parties are thought about single people in the eyes of the law.
  • Legal Separation: In a legal separation, the couple remains lawfully married. This can have implications for concerns such as taxes, health insurance, and social security benefits.
  • Financial Obligations

  • Divorce: Throughout a divorce, possessions and debts acquired throughout the marriage are generally divided between the partners in a fair way based on state laws.
  • Legal Separation: In a legal separation, couples may still require to address financial matters such as spousal support or child assistance. However, properties and financial obligations may not be divided in the same way as in a divorce.
  • Potential for Reconciliation

  • Divorce: When going through a divorce, reconciliation is not usually thought about as part of the process. When the divorce is finalized, it is challenging to reverse.
  • Legal Separation: Legal separation allows couples the opportunity to reconcile without going through the divorce process. They can select to resume their marital relationship without needing to remarry.
  • Legal Process and Requirements

  • Divorce: The process of obtaining a divorce includes submitting a petition with the court, serving the spouse with divorce papers, and going to hearings. Divorce often requires more official legal proceedings.
  • Legal Separation: While legal separation also includes submitting a petition, it may not require the exact same level of procedure as divorce. Couples may have more flexibility in regards to reaching an agreement without comprehensive court involvement.
  • Custody and Visitation Rights

  • Divorce: In a divorce, custody and visitation rights are generally determined during the proceedings. The court will think about the very best interests of the kid when making decisions.
  • Legal Separation: Comparable to divorce, legal separation can include dealing with custody and visitation rights. Nevertheless, couples may have more flexibility in working out these plans beyond court.
  • Emotional Considerations

  • Divorce: The decision to pursue a divorce often represents a complete breakdown in the marital relationship and can be emotionally challenging for both celebrations involved.
  • Legal Separation: Legal separation provides a happy medium for couples who might doubt about ending their marital relationship entirely. It enables extra time and space to resolve emotional issues.

  • What is a legal separation agreement? A legal separation agreement is a legally binding document that describes the terms of a legal separation. It covers aspects such as child custody, spousal support, division of possessions, and obligations throughout the separation period.

  • Can I produce a separation agreement without a lawyer? Yes, it is possible to produce a separation agreement without a lawyer's participation. However, it is suggested to look for legal guidance to guarantee that the contract meets all legal requirements and secures your rights.

  • What is the expense of a legal separation compared to a divorce? The expense of a legal separation can differ depending upon aspects such as lawyer costs, court filing charges, and any additional professional services needed. In general, legal separation may be cheaper than divorce due to the potentially much shorter process.

  • What are the differences between marriage separation and legal separation? Marriage separation refers to the act of spouses living apart while still being legally married. Legal separation, on the other hand, involves acquiring a court order to formalize the separation and address various legal aspects of the relationship.

  • Is mediation readily available for legal separations? Yes, couples going through a legal separation can select mediation as an alternative to dealing with conflicts in court. Mediation allows for open interaction and settlement with the assistance of a neutral 3rd party.

  • Are possessions divided during a divorce or legal separation? While assets might be divided during both divorce and legal separation, the particular division may differ. Divorce typically includes a more detailed division of properties acquired throughout the marital relationship, while legal separation might have more versatile arrangements.
